Rising Tide in Cryptocurrency: A New Era of Digital Asset Expansion

The nascent months of 2024 have heralded a pivotal phase in the cryptocurrency domain, primarily fueled by the eagerly anticipated sanctioning of Bitcoin ETFs. This pivotal move, paired with a potent surge in valuation, resulted in bitcoin carving a fresh zenith in its price chart. Not only did this milestone pave the way for bitcoin’s re-entry into the institutional arena, but it also hinted at the onset of a prospective bullish phase in the digital market.

A kaleidoscope of emergent ventures, ranging from Bittensor and ZKSync to the likes of Bonk and Dogwifhat, have sparked noteworthy market dynamics. These initiatives, coupled with a tangible upswing in value across diverse digital assets, have outlined the heightened volatility reflective of investors’ search for amplified gains.

The landscape of digital currencies is being molded by breakthrough trends, as altcoins forge ahead with a dedicated emphasis on innovation and sustainable practices that unveil novel applications. Among these trends, re-staking has emerged as a pioneering concept, rewarding token holders who re-invest their staking proceeds back into the system, thereby compounding their financial growth. Pioneers of this method include EigenLayer, EtherFi, and Renzo, striving to fortify their networks’ robustness.

Moreover, the escalated adoption of Layer2 scaling mechanisms such as Optimistic Rollups and zkRollups is revolutionizing transaction efficiency and affordability on platforms like Arbitrum and Starknet. Additionally, the pursuit of interoperability across blockchain networks, exemplified by projects like Axelar and Stargate, is set to forge a more cohesive and efficient blockchain cosmos.

Marking the next stride in evolution, modular blockchains like Celestia are redefining flexibility in the digital arena, providing a canvas for the integration of varied building blocks. In parallel, transformative advances in the realm of Ethereum Virtual Machines are ushered in by entities like Sei and Nomad, significantly elevating both processing speeds and efficiency.

While present market indicators suggest an in-progress bull market, with large-cap cryptocurrencies still seeing potential for growth, the emergence of smaller coins outshining larger markets is not far on the horizon. Advantages:

– Increased innovation and competition within the cryptocurrency space can lead to the development of new products and services.
– Cryptocurrency offers an alternative financial system that is decentralized and not subject to traditional banking limitations.
– Investors have the opportunity for high returns due to market volatility and the potential growth of digital assets.
– Advancements in technology, like modular blockchains and Layer2 scaling, can significantly improve transaction efficiency.

Disadvantages:

– High volatility in cryptocurrency markets can lead to significant financial losses for investors.
– Regulatory uncertainty may hinder cryptocurrency adoption and create challenges for businesses in the sector.
– Security risks such as hacking and fraud are prevalent issues within the cryptocurrency landscape.
– Cryptocurrencies can be complex and difficult to understand for the average consumer, potentially leading to ill-informed investment decisions.
